What are User Permissions?

User permissions are a crucial aspect of Linux user administration. Permissions determine what users can and cannot do within the system. These permissions are usually assigned based on the user’s role and responsibilities within the organization. Permissions can vary based on the level of access required, and different permissions may allow users to perform specific tasks.

Types of User Permissions

There are different types of user permissions, such as read, write, execute, and administrative. The read permission allows users to view files, the write permission allows them to modify or create files, and the execute permission allows them to run programs or scripts. The administrative permission grants users access to system-level operations such as adding or removing users, installing software, and managing system settings.

Importance of User Permissions

User permissions are essential for maintaining the security and integrity of a system. Without proper permissions, users can inadvertently or intentionally cause damage to the system or access sensitive data. By limiting access to only those who need it, the risk of unauthorized access or malicious activity is reduced.

Joining a Domain: What Does it Mean?

Joining a domain is the process of adding a Linux system to a Windows Active Directory domain. This process allows the Linux system to share resources such as files and printers with other systems within the domain. By joining a domain, users can also authenticate with their Windows credentials, simplifying the login process.

Key takeaway: User permissions are crucial for maintaining the security and integrity of a Linux system, and joining a domain offers several advantages, including centralized management of user accounts and access control. Adding user permissions to join a domain requires configuring DNS settings, assigning user permissions, and verifying successful domain integration. Following best practices for user permissions and domain integration can ensure the security and productivity of a system.

Benefits of Joining a Domain

Joining a domain offers several advantages, including centralized management of user accounts and access control. By integrating with the Windows domain, Linux systems can share resources and data with other systems on the network, increasing productivity and collaboration. Additionally, domain integration provides a seamless login experience for users, eliminating the need for separate credentials.

Requirements for Joining a Domain

To join a domain, the Linux system must have the necessary software and configuration settings. The system must be running Samba, a free and open-source software suite that provides file and print services between Windows and Linux systems. Additionally, the system must be configured to use the correct DNS settings and have the appropriate user permissions to join the domain.

Adding User Permissions to Join Domain

Adding user permissions to join a domain requires several steps. First, the user must have administrative access to the Linux system. Next, the system must be configured with the correct DNS settings and network connectivity to the Windows domain. Finally, the user must have the necessary permissions to join the domain.

One key takeaway from this text is that user permissions are a crucial aspect of Linux user administration, necessary for maintaining the security and integrity of the system. Joining a domain offers several benefits, including centralized management of user accounts and access control, as well as a seamless login experience for users. Adding user permissions to join a domain requires configuring the DNS settings and assigning the necessary permissions to the user. Best practices for user permissions and domain integration include limiting access, assigning permissions based on the user’s role, regularly reviewing and updating permissions, and monitoring system logs for suspicious activity.

Configuring DNS Settings

Before joining a domain, the Linux system must be configured with the correct DNS settings. The system must be able to resolve the domain name and locate the domain controller on the network. This can be done by editing the /etc/resolv.conf file and adding the domain name and IP address of the domain controller.

Assigning User Permissions

To add user permissions to join a domain, the user must be added to the Samba user database. This is done using the smbpasswd command, which adds the user’s credentials to the database. Once the user is added to the database, they can be assigned the necessary permissions to join the domain using the net join command.

Verifying User Permissions

After adding user permissions, it is essential to verify that the user can join the domain successfully. This can be done by attempting to join the domain using the user’s credentials. If the user is unable to join the domain, further troubleshooting may be necessary to identify the issue.

Troubleshooting User Permissions

If a user is unable to join a domain, there may be several reasons why. One common issue is incorrect DNS settings. If the Linux system is unable to locate the domain controller, the user will be unable to join the domain. Ensure that the /etc/resolv.conf file is correctly configured with the domain name and IP address of the domain controller.

Another issue may be incorrect user permissions. Ensure that the user has administrative access to the Linux system and has been added to the Samba user database. Additionally, ensure that the user has the necessary permissions to join the domain using the net join command.

Key takeaway:

User permissions are crucial for maintaining the security and integrity of a system. By assigning permissions based on a user’s role and responsibilities, access can be limited to only those who need it, reducing the risk of unauthorized access or malicious activity. Joining a domain offers several advantages, including centralized management of user accounts and access control, and can increase productivity and collaboration within a network. To ensure the security and productivity of a system, it is essential to follow best practices for user permissions and domain integration, such as regularly reviewing and updating user permissions, monitoring system logs for suspicious activity, and ensuring that all systems are running the latest software and security updates.

Best Practices for User Permissions and Domain Integration

To ensure the security and productivity of a system, it is essential to follow best practices for user permissions and domain integration. These practices include:

  • Limiting access to only those who need it
  • Assigning permissions based on the user’s role and responsibilities
  • Regularly reviewing and updating user permissions
  • Ensuring that all systems are running the latest software and security updates
  • Monitoring system logs for suspicious activity

By following these best practices, users can ensure the integrity and security of their systems and data.

FAQs – User Permissions to Join Domain

What are user permissions to join a domain?

User permissions to join a domain refer to the level of access and rights that a user has to join a computer to a domain. Depending on the organization’s policies and the computer’s operating system, users may need specific permissions to join a domain. Typically, users need administrative privileges on the computer to complete the join process. This means that they have the right to make changes to the computer settings, including joining the domain.

How do I grant user permissions to join a domain?

To grant user permissions to join a domain, you must have administrative privileges on the computer. Depending on the operating system, you can grant these permissions by adjusting the local group policy settings or using the Active Directory Users and Computers tool. The process of granting permissions may vary, but generally, you need to add the user account to a group or give them specific rights. Once the user has the appropriate permissions, they can join the computer to the domain.

Why do users need permission to join a domain?

Users need permission to join a domain to ensure that they have the proper level of access and authority to make changes to the computer. Joining a computer to a domain involves modifying important settings and establishing a trust relationship between the computer and the domain. Without the proper permissions, users may not have the authority to complete these tasks. Furthermore, granting access to specific users helps to maintain security and ensure compliance with organizational policies.

Who has the authority to grant user permissions to join a domain?

The IT department or an IT administrator typically has the authority to grant user permissions to join a domain. This is because joining a computer to a domain involves modifying important settings and can have security implications. The IT department is responsible for ensuring that users have the appropriate level of access to complete their job duties. Additionally, only users with administrative privileges on the computer can grant user permissions to join a domain. This helps to maintain security and prevent unauthorized access to the computer network.

What happens if a user does not have permission to join a domain?

If a user does not have permission to join a domain, they will not be able to complete the join process. Depending on the operating system and computer settings, they may see an error message or be unable to access certain features. This can be frustrating for users who need to join a domain to access shared resources or collaborate with other users on the network. In this case, the user should contact the IT department for assistance in obtaining the proper permissions.